The Rise of DIY vs. Full-Service Models
Historically, buying blinds involved a local company coming to measure and fit. This full-service model, epitomised by companies like Hillarys and Apollo Blinds, remains popular, particularly for customers who prefer a hands-off approach or have complex window requirements. These companies leverage their local advisors and expert fitters, guaranteeing precision and professional installation. Their pricing typically reflects this added value.
However, the internet democratised the process. Online-only retailers like Blinds 2go and Web-Blinds pioneered the DIY model. By providing detailed measuring guides, video tutorials, and free samples, they empowered consumers to measure and fit their own blinds. This significantly reduced overheads, allowing them to offer more competitive pricing and a much wider range of fabrics and styles than a traditional local shop might stock. The success of this model is evident in the sheer volume of products sold and the high customer review ratings these companies often achieve.

Child Safety Regulations and Blind Design
Child safety in homes is a critical concern, particularly when it comes to window coverings with cords or chains that can pose a strangulation risk to young children. In the UK, strict regulations are in place to ensure that blinds are designed and installed to minimise these hazards. Any reputable blind retailer, including 1stblindsforchoice.co.uk, must adhere to these standards. First-touch.co.uk Review
The UK Child Safety Standard (BS EN 13120)
The primary regulation governing internal blinds in the UK is BS EN 13120:2009 + A1:2014 – Internal Blinds – Performance Requirements including safety. This standard, made mandatory by the General Product Safety Regulations 2005, dictates how blinds must be designed and installed to protect children.
Key requirements of this standard include:
- Maximum Cord/Chain Length: Cords and chains on blinds must be manufactured to a maximum length, or be supplied with safety devices to ensure they are kept out of reach of young children.
- Safety Devices: All new blinds with operating cords or chains must be supplied with a child safety device. This device must be installed at the point of fitting.
- Installation Height: If the bottom of the cord/chain is less than 1.5 metres from the floor, it must be permanently secured with a safety device.
- Breakaway Connectors: Certain looped cords (e.g., on Roman blinds) must be designed with breakaway connectors that separate under a specific load, preventing a hazardous loop.
- Warning Labels: Blinds must come with clear warning labels advising of the strangulation hazard and instructing on the use of safety devices.
Data Point: RoSPA (The Royal Society for the Prevention of Accidents) highlights that between 2001 and 2017, there were at least 33 deaths in the UK due to blind cords, primarily involving children aged 1-3. This underscores the severity of the risk and the necessity of strict adherence to safety standards.

Eco-Friendly & Sustainable Practices in Blind Manufacturing
In an increasingly environmentally conscious world, consumers are not only looking for quality and affordability but also for products that align with sustainable and ethical manufacturing practices. While the core business of 1stblindsforchoice.co.uk is selling and fitting blinds, discussing their potential role in sustainability (or the industry’s role in general) is relevant for a comprehensive review.
Material Sourcing and Production
The environmental impact of blinds largely stems from their materials and manufacturing processes.
- PVC/Vinyl: Many Venetian and faux wood blinds use PVC. While durable and water-resistant, PVC production can be energy-intensive and involves chemicals. Concerns about plastic waste and microplastics are also growing. Companies can mitigate this by sourcing recycled PVC or looking for more sustainable alternatives.
- Aluminium: Metal Venetian blinds are typically made from aluminium. Aluminium is highly recyclable, and a significant portion of new aluminium comes from recycled content. However, primary aluminium production is very energy-intensive.
- Fabrics (Polyester, Cotton, Linen): Roller, Vertical, and Roman blinds often use fabric. Polyester is synthetic and derived from petroleum, but recycled polyester is becoming more common. Natural fibres like cotton and linen are biodegradable but can have high water and pesticide footprints, unless organically grown.
- Wood: Real wood blinds (not listed on 1stblindsforchoice.co.uk’s homepage but common in the market) should ideally come from sustainably managed forests, certified by organisations like FSC (Forest Stewardship Council).

Energy Efficiency Benefits of Blinds
Beyond their direct material impact, blinds play a crucial role in home energy efficiency, which is an important aspect of environmental responsibility. Edinburghemergencyplumberteam.co.uk Review
- Insulation: Blinds, especially those with thicker fabrics (like blackout or interlined Roman blinds mentioned by 1stblindsforchoice.co.uk) or honeycomb/cellular designs (not listed on the homepage but common in the market), can act as an insulating layer. They reduce heat loss in winter and heat gain in summer.
- Sunlight Control: Blinds allow occupants to control natural light, reducing the need for artificial lighting during the day. By blocking direct sunlight, they can also prevent rooms from overheating, reducing reliance on air conditioning.
- Thermal Performance: The UK government has been increasingly focused on improving the energy efficiency of homes. Well-chosen blinds can contribute to this. For example, a study by the University of Salford found that well-fitted blinds can reduce heat loss through windows by up to 15%.
